mysql5.7安装报错:服务无法启动,服务没有报告任何错误

今天安装了一下mysql的5.7版本,遇到一些奇葩问题。

我下载的是压缩包64位,直接解压安装的。

第一次安装时,直接什么都没有配置,解压后直接用管理员命令行输入 mysqld -install

这个时候会提示找不到/data文件夹,我就在mysql根目录下建了data文件夹,

启动的时候就报错 服务无法启动,服务没有报告任何错误,如图:

mysql5.7安装报错:服务无法启动,服务没有报告任何错误_第1张图片

本人反复用 mysqld -remove移除再安装好几次,都没法解决。

第二次本人采用配置 my.ini文件指定目录安装

my.ini文件内容如下

mysql5.7安装报错:服务无法启动,服务没有报告任何错误_第2张图片

 

mysql5.7安装报错:服务无法启动,服务没有报告任何错误_第3张图片

 

[mysqld]
port=3306
basedir=D://softWare//mysql-5.7.23-winx64
datadir=D://softWare//mysql-5.7.23-winx64//data
skip-grant-tables
 

发现配置文件中不能用一个反斜杠\,需要用两个//斜杠。

正确步骤如下:

1.解压后,在目录下创建my.ini文件和data文件夹

mysql5.7安装报错:服务无法启动,服务没有报告任何错误_第4张图片

2.管理员命令窗口中输入 mysqld -install

mysql5.7安装报错:服务无法启动,服务没有报告任何错误_第5张图片

 

3.管理员命令窗口中输入 mysqld -initialize-insecure

mysql5.7安装报错:服务无法启动,服务没有报告任何错误_第6张图片

4.管理员命令窗口中输入 net start mysql

mysql5.7安装报错:服务无法启动,服务没有报告任何错误_第7张图片

 

大功告成!!!

你可能感兴趣的:(MySql)